The Importance of Stability and Strength Training for Longevity
As we age, the way we approach exercise should shift from focusing solely on performance to prioritizing the preservation and longevity of our bodies. In a recent discussion, the significance of core stability and strength training was emphasized, particularly in preventing injuries and maintaining independence in daily activities.
Why Stability Matters
Many people underestimate the role of stability in their physical health. Energy leakage during movement not only affects performance but also predisposes individuals to injuries. It is essential to engage in exercises that enhance core stability, allowing us to perform daily tasks—like climbing stairs or lifting objects—without the risk of injury.
Lessons from Elite Athletes
A striking point made in the discussion was the value of learning from elite athletes. While some healthcare professionals may dismiss the relevance of elite performance to their elderly or sick patients, understanding what the human body can achieve can inform better practices for rehabilitation and strength training.
Emotional Encounters with Patients
A poignant story was shared about a woman in her early 70s who felt defeated by her limitations. After demonstrating simple movements and teaching her how to properly engage her body, she realized she didn’t have to leave her home. This transformation highlights the profound impact that proper movement education can have on individuals, regardless of their age or health status.
The Shift Towards Strength Training for All Ages
There has been a noticeable shift in how society views strength training. It is increasingly recognized as essential for everyone, not just young athletes. Strength and stability are now acknowledged as critical components of health, contributing to better overall quality of life as we age.
